    dog has struvite crystals in his urine...

     So, my 1 1/2 yr old pitbull has struvite crystals in his urine. He's eating hill's s/d for 30 days and taking Amoxi for 14. He's still hungry, and I,m wondering if theres something else I can give him, like chicken, with his food, that will not be bad for his condition??? He's 50 lbs and eating one can of the s/d with 3/4 cup water mixed in in the a.m. and one in the p.m. I will give him more if thats my only option, but its expensive! ($30 for 6 days worth of food!)

    Struvite crystals are not horrible.  Really they aren't.  They are FAR FAR easier to cope with than oxylate crystals.  (those usually can't be prevented easily and they are genetic more than dietary)

    Treats really shouldn't be a problem either -- not unless there are more urinary problems than the vet has described to you.

    I'll add that if you have them culture the urine to find out what antibiotic she needs to be on--they can get her on the right drug for the right bacteria.  And, she might need an extended dose.  Then a re-check to make sure the infection is gone. But, once they clear the infection normally the struvites aren't an issue. 

    Willow never had to stay on any particular food once the infection was gone.
